One of the main goals of sustainable wall construction is to reduce the carbon footprint of buildings. Traditional building materials such as concrete and steel have a high carbon footprint due to the energy-intensive processes involved in their production. In contrast, sustainable materials such as recycled steel, reclaimed wood, and natural stone have a much lower impact on the environment. By choosing these materials for wall construction, builders can significantly reduce the amount of greenhouse gas emissions associated with their projects.
In addition to using sustainable materials, builders are also adopting innovative construction techniques to create more energy-efficient walls. One popular method is the use of double-stud walls, which consist of two layers of studs with a gap in between. This gap is filled with insulation, creating a highly energy-efficient wall system that helps regulate indoor temperatures and reduce heating and cooling costs. By increasing the thermal resistance of walls, builders can create more comfortable and sustainable living spaces for occupants.

One innovative approach to sustainable wall construction is the use of green walls or living walls. These vertical gardens are created by attaching plants to the exterior or interior of a building, providing numerous environmental benefits. Green walls help improve air quality, reduce urban heat island effect, and enhance biodiversity in urban areas. By incorporating living walls into building designs, builders can create a more sustainable and aesthetically pleasing environment for occupants while also promoting biodiversity and wildlife habitat in urban settings.
